Srinagar, May 05:

Divisional Administration Kashmir in collaboration with Institute of Mental Health and Neurosciences Kashmir (IMHANS-K) has revealed a questionnaire to help people to self-assess their level of anxiety and psycho social distress, insomnia disorder in current second wave of COVID-19 pandemic.


The questionnaire is formulated in English and is based on easily understood questions for wider public reach. People accessing this questionnaire are assessed anonymously and will get their scores as green, orange and red.

The Self Assessment questionnaire is a part of ongoing tele-psychiatry initiative started by the Divisional Administration to treat and counsel patients with pre existing mental health problems such as anxiety , depression , bipolar disorders , paranoia etc .
The initiative has witnessed a huge flow of calls for Tele – Psychiatry consultations which was started in the Kashmir Division in view of the rise in Mental Health issues .
Divisional Commissioner Kashmir Pandurang K Pole has been pivotal in making this initiative a reality and was devised under his guidance in view of numerous national and international reports depicting adverse effects of COVID-19 pandemic on mental health of general population.
While rolling out the online self assessment questionnaire , Divisional Commissioner said that the health response of Kashmir amid this pandemic has been exceptional and pioneering in many respect and mental health response has been one of the top priority of current administration.
Head of the Department ,IMHANS said that people should benefit from the questionnaire for having the self assessment of their mental well being besides people falling in orange and red categories should seek help Tele- psychiatry Helpline.
He added that the initiative has treated thousands of people and has been effective in settling the mental health issues of people including those with pre existing mental illnesses.
Earlier a team of psychiatrists / psychologists counselling has been started to help people currently in home situation, guide about precautions, maintaining Covid behaviour, precautions and assist general public on living a healthy life during the pandemic.
